Join us for the inaugural MetroParks of Butler County Winter Hike Series! This weekly hiking event will highlight the beauty of Butler County in winter by exploring a different park each week. These guided hikes will average about 3 miles and end with a hot beverage and a bowl of soup.
We are looking for volunteers to act as group sweeps working in pairs of two bringing up the rear of each group making sure no one is separated and letting the staff lead know about any issues the group may encounter from behind. Volunteers need to be comfortable hiking 3 miles. Volunteers must be 14 years or older. First aid training is a plus but not required.
